A new Italian restaurant has taken over the former Mimi’s Old Town Mexican Restaurant space at 321 N. Mead. Introducing Bocatto: Eatery and Pasta. They recently opened and of course, we had to stop by and check out the new eatery in Old Town.

The menu featured pastas, paninis and a ton more. Many Italian classics and pretty much any popular Italian dish could be had. We started our visit off with the scampi shrimp toast. The shrimp and sauce it was doused in were excellent; nice sweet flavor to them. The toast, unfortunately, was way too hard. Biting into it was a chore, and felt as if it was nearly rock solid. This was some feedback we did provide them.

For lunch, the gentleman who joined me had the chicken marsala which he did enjoy.

For my entrees, I decided to go with two to get a sampling of different items. I had the balsamic portabello panini and the roasted herb chicken.

The latter was probably my favorite; juicy, succulent chicken with a nicely seasoned skin that was loaded with flavor. The dish sat in some sort of lemon sauce which gave the whole meal a lighter, refreshing bite. As for the panini, I wasn’t too fond of the fries that came with it, they could have used some salt or something. Loved the huge portabello mushroom, but the ciabatta bun roll just didn’t do it for me. It lacked the chewy sweetness, the bun was tougher than I was expecting.

There were some bright spots and low lights to our lunch at Bocatto. It may have been our server’s first day working because the attentiveness wasn’t there. Lack of refills, getting us our ticket; basic things that took away from the entire experience that was already iffy.

I was going to write a review immediately after eating, but wanted to take the night to think it over. Bocatto didn’t exactly wow me, but I’m hoping over time they can.
